The Digital Transformation Imperative

Digital transformation is the integration of digital technology into all aspects of a business, fundamentally changing how it operates and delivers value to customers. Key factors driving the digital transformation imperative include:

Customer Expectations: Customers increasingly demand seamless, personalized, and digital experiences from businesses.

Technological Advancements: Rapid advancements in technologies such as artificial intelligence (AI), cloud computing, and the Internet of Things (IoT) have made digital transformation more feasible and accessible.

Competitive Pressure: Businesses are recognizing that staying competitive requires embracing digital innovations and staying ahead of disruptors.

The Acceleration of Digital Transformation

The pace of digital transformation has accelerated for several reasons:

COVID-19 Pandemic: The pandemic forced many businesses to expedite their digital transformation efforts to adapt to remote work, e-commerce, and changing customer behaviors.

Data-Driven Insights: Access to vast amounts of data and sophisticated analytics tools have enabled companies to make data-driven decisions and enhance customer experiences.

Cloud Adoption: Cloud computing has become a cornerstone of digital transformation, providing scalability, flexibility, and cost-efficiency.

Impact on Businesses

Digital transformation has profound implications for businesses:

Operational Efficiency: Automation and digitization streamline processes, reducing costs and improving efficiency.

Customer Engagement: Digital tools and data-driven insights enable personalized customer experiences, enhancing loyalty and retention.

Innovation: Digital transformation fosters a culture of innovation, allowing companies to develop new products and services.

Data Security: As businesses digitize, cybersecurity becomes paramount to protect sensitive data from cyber threats.

Challenges and Considerations

Digital transformation is not without its challenges:

Legacy Systems: Many businesses grapple with legacy systems that are difficult to integrate with modern technology.

Skills Gap: Finding and retaining talent with digital expertise is a challenge for some organizations.

Change Management: Successfully navigating the cultural and organizational shifts that come with digital transformation can be complex.

The Future of Business

The future of business will be shaped by digital transformation in several ways:

Data-Centric Operations: Companies will increasingly rely on data to inform decisions, improve operations, and drive innovation.

Ecosystem Partnerships: Businesses will collaborate with tech partners and startups to access cutting-edge technologies and expand their digital capabilities.

Sustainability: Sustainability will be integrated into digital transformation efforts, with a focus on eco-friendly practices and products.
